Epi-Fluorescence with LED Advantage
Intensity from a conventional lamp decreases through its life, which means that illumination varies dramatically over time. The lifetime of LEDs far exceeds that of these older lamps, ex. Mercury, Metal Halide, Xenon models and intensity remains broadly constant throughout its life, providing a stable, repeatable light source. The MT6300CL is equipped with the PE-300L/LEDMT, a simple white light LED microscope illuminator. It provides a broad spectrum of illumination, covering the excitation bands of common fluorophores such as DAPI, CFP, Aqua, FITC, TRITC, TxRed, Cy5 and many more. Operation is by a remote manual control pod with instant on/off and intensity control from 0-100%. The newly enhanced PE-300L/LEDMT runs under 60 Watts at its full power. That is almost a quadruple efficiency increase, and compares to other LED technology which uses 120 to 350 Watts. This leap forward in technology makes LEDs more attractive when compared to old Mercury or Metal Halide technology, with no mercury to dispose of and lower energy costs due to low power consumption and precise control.
